android - 重命名包名后"Cannot find symbol R"错误

标签 android

重命名我的项目包名称(使用 Refactor)后,出现此错误:

Error:(7, 44) error: cannot find symbol class R

我所有的 R 用法都是无效的。我试图手动修复它,但它对我不起作用。 Invalidate chases/Restart 对我也没有帮助。

最佳答案

尝试以下操作:

Try deleting your R.java file , android studio will regenerate it.

Clean Project

Rebuild Project

并检查:

Check the AndroidManifest.xml, there's a package attribute on the top-level element

(好吧,这取决于你如何重命名你的包名)

关于android - 重命名包名后"Cannot find symbol R"错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33826801/

相关文章:

java - 如何在Android中读取文件

java - 试图让我的 ListView 多选,但我无法让它工作

android - 禁用横向全屏

android - 安卓时间选择器

java - 为什么 HashMap 方法返回空对象引用?

android - 如何在没有辅助功能权限的情况下检测输入法选择器的可见性

java - 如何运行 Endomondo 移动应用程序的 "Start tracking" Activity

android - 如何在 Android 中动态更改按钮样式?

android - 捕获的图像未存储在 android 11 中

android - 在android中接收短信-意外停止